Gold found under Southwest Highway Part 1
I have discovered a new style of gold mineralisation associated with the Donnybrook epithermal goldfield... In short, epithermal gold means Geysers, hydrothermal ejection breccia and hot spring-fed streams lined with hematite, colloidal silica and gold. I have found remnants of this mineralised hydrothermal sediment and plan to describe it further by undertaking a Masters in Geology at Curtin University in 2023. Introducing Mt Cara and the Hunter Venture Mine
Переглядів 5705 років тому
A trip of discovery to Mt Cara Donnybrook Western Australia. Discovered in 1898 and worked for 5 years, Mt Cara and the Hunter Venture mine sparked a mini gold rush in Donnybrook. The Hunter Venture mine was re-opened in the 1930s for a bit but then closed due to a tradgic death and flooding issues.
